Re: Dallas Love Field Airport
Having worked at the airport long enough, there are plans to do a few things to the facility. One is a concept to extend runway 31R/13L out over Bachman Lake and partly over NW Highway to accommodate larger planes. DO NOT ask me how that even seem feasible.
